The possible emission rate of particle-stable tetraneutron, a four-neutron system whose existence has been long debated within the scientific community, has now been investigated. Researchers looked into tetraneutron emission from thermal fission of 235U by irradiating a sample of 88SrCO3 in a nuclear research reactor and analyzing it via -ray spectroscopy.

A research team has developed an innovative screening test. With a blood sample from the expectant mother, they can scrutinize all the genes in the fetus. The findings indicate that the new test, named desNIPT, has demonstrated effectiveness in identifying alterations in fetal genes -- a leading factor in severe congenital diseases.

A team of researchers has found that Paxlovid (Nirmatrelvir-ritonavir) did not reduce the risk of developing long COVID for vaccinated, non-hospitalized individuals during their first COVID-19 infection. They also found a higher proportion of individuals than previously reported with rebound symptoms and test-positivity after taking Paxlovid.
